| <?xml version="1.0"?> |
| <template |
| format="1" |
| revision="1" |
| name="New Service" |
| description="Creates a new service class"> |
| |
| <parameter |
| id="className" |
| name="Class Name" |
| type="string" |
| constraints="class|unique|nonempty" |
| default="MyService" /> |
| |
| <parameter |
| id="isExported" |
| name="Exported" |
| type="boolean" |
| default="true" |
| help="Whether or not components of other applications can invoke the service or interact with it" /> |
| |
| <parameter |
| id="isEnabled" |
| name="Enabled" |
| type="boolean" |
| default="true" |
| help="Whether or not the service can be instantiated by the system" /> |
| |
| <globals file="globals.xml.ftl" /> |
| <execute file="recipe.xml.ftl" /> |
| |
| </template> |